                       All that you need .....
                                              
                                              The following is a list of all the essentials that you will need for your short
                                              traverse thru the mountains.

                                              * Three pairs of Jeans

                                              * Three full sleeves shirts

                                              * One full sleeves sweater that will keep you warm 

                                              * One light-weight jacket filled with down feather to keep you warm in temperatures                                                           
                                                 ranging from +6 degrees centigrade to -2 degrees centigrade.

                                              * Two pairs of thick long length socks to keep your legs warm

                                              * A wool cap for early mornings and night.

                                              * Warm hand gloves

                                              * Tamrac or any other make of Waterproof Camera Bags

                                              * Shoes : Please ensure that your shoes are well worn in for at least three months          
                                                 or else you will certainly slip and fall. The ideal shoes for trekking over boulders,
                                                 landslides, scree slopes, wading thru streams etc are the good old fashioned tennis
                                                 shoes with treads on the sole. You will still find these at rock bottom prices at Bata
                                                 shoe stores and you might want to try those Chinese shoe stores. I am suggesting
                                                 these old fashioned tennis shoes because there soles are very flexible and can grip
                                                 well. The only dis-advantage with these shoes are they wont keep your feet very
                                                 warm or dry.  Use a warm pair of long length socks to keep your feet warm. There 
                                                 are several other expensive shoes in the market which are also recommended for
                                                 comfort for example those aerosol soles and woodpecker shoes they avertise on telly.
                                                These shoes are very very very comfortable and your feet wont ache after end of trek.
                                                There is even a shoe that costs USD $730.00 plus taxes which was advertised in OutsideMag.
                                                Take a look its an exquisite shoe meant for ordinary commoners to carry on their head !!
                                                 Dont get carried away by the sight of some porter climbing with military boots !!
                                                 Tese porters are very sure footed mountain goats and we are not !!
